Course Details

  • Ethical Camping Principles: An introduction to the core values and principles of ethical camping, including minimum impact practices and respect for the natural world.
  • Site Selection: Techniques for selecting suitable campsites that minimize environmental impact, including considerations for soil, vegetation, and wildlife.
  • Waste Management: Best practices for managing waste while camping, including strategies for reducing, reusing, and disposing of waste in an environmentally friendly manner.
  • Fire Safety and Management: Guidelines for building and managing campfires safely and sustainably, including fire restrictions, fire ring construction, and fire suppression techniques.
  • Food Preparation and Storage: Tips for preparing and storing food in a way that minimizes waste and attracts wildlife, as well as strategies for reducing food-related impacts on the environment.
  • Leave No Trace® Principles: An overview of the seven Leave No Trace® principles and how to apply them in different camping scenarios.
  • Human Waste Disposal: Strategies for disposing of human waste in a responsible and sustainable manner, including the use of cat holes, waste digesters, and portable toilets.
  • Water Collection and Treatment: Techniques for collecting and treating water from natural sources, including the use of filters, purifiers, and chemical treatments.
  • Group Camping Ethics: Best practices for camping in groups, including strategies for minimizing impact, managing group dynamics, and promoting environmental stewardship.

Career Path

The Professional Certificate in Ethical Camping Techniques is an excellent way to dive into the ever-growing ecotourism industry.

With a focus on sustainable practices, this program offers various roles in the UK job market, each with its unique salary ranges and skill demands.

Here's a closer look at the opportunities awaiting successful graduates. 1. Camp Manager (20%) Camp managers oversee daily operations at eco-friendly campsites, ensuring compliance with environmental standards and guest satisfaction.

The average salary in the UK is around Β£25,000 to Β£35,000 per year. 2. Eco-tour Guide (30%) Eco-tour guides lead small groups on low-impact outdoor adventures, sharing their knowledge of local flora, fauna, and conservation efforts.

UK eco-tour guides typically earn between Β£18,000 and Β£28,000 annually. 3. Conservation Specialist (25%) Conservation specialists work to preserve natural areas, focusing on habitat restoration and wildlife protection.

In the UK, these professionals earn Β£25,000 to Β£40,000 per year. 4. Waste Management Officer (15%) Waste management officers develop and implement waste reduction strategies, minimizing the ecological footprint of campsites and other outdoor facilities.

UK salaries for this role range from Β£22,000 to Β£35,000. 5. Sustainability Educator (10%) Sustainability educators teach guests and staff about environmentally friendly practices, fostering a culture of responsible tourism.

In the UK, sustainability educators can expect to earn Β£20,000 to Β£30,000 annually.
